Aggressive
Aggressive adjective - Having or showing a bold forcefulness in the pursuit of a goal.
Usage example: if you don't take a more aggressive approach to this yard pretty soon, the weeds are going to take over completely
Determined is a synonym for aggressive in assertive topic. In some cases you can use "Determined" instead an adjective "Aggressive".
Determined
Determined adjective - Fully committed to achieving a goal.
Aggressive is a synonym for determined in assertive topic. Sometimes you can use "Aggressive" instead an adjective "Determined".
